Конфигурация нескольких серверов под FreeBSD и Win2003

Как создать сервер оптимальной конфигурации.

Модераторы: Trinity admin`s, Free-lance moderator`s

Ответить
vinnispb
Junior member
Сообщения: 4
Зарегистрирован: 10 мар 2008, 14:50
Откуда: Санкт-Петербург

Конфигурация нескольких серверов под FreeBSD и Win2003

Сообщение vinnispb » 11 мар 2008, 18:43

Добрый день.

Появилась необходимость модернизировать серверную.
Сразу оговорюсь, что сейчас все что есть, собрано как говорится из того что было, но  работает. Есть желание собрать все железо на серверных платформах, упаковать в шкаф. Перечитал много информации в этом форуме, кое-что для себя выяснил. Сейчас необходимо хотя бы примерно определится с конфигурациями и посчитать сколько это будет стоить дабы составить смету. В дальнейшем если по ценам все устроит, можем воспользоваться услугами вашей компании.

Итак, что необходимо:

1. Интернет шлюз.
OC FreeBSD 6.x, IPFW + pipes, NAT. Канал в интернет 10 Мбит, загрузка редко привышает 50%.
Предполагаемое решение:
Платформа 5015*, Core2Duo, 2Gb RAM,
RAID-контроллер Adaptec 3405 или что-нибудь 2-х портовое совместимое с freebsd. (может 3Ware 9650SE- 2LP ?). 2 HDD SATA по 160Gb в зеркале.

2. Почтовый сервер.
ОС FreeBSD 6.x, Postfix, spamassassin, Mysql, drweb. Среднее кол-во писем, доставляемых ежесуточно в ящики (т.е. не считая спама, отброшенного на разных этапах проверок) около 2 тысяч. Объем почтовых ящиков около 20Гб.
Предполагаемое решение, думаю, такое же как и в п. 1

3. Вебсервер.
OC FreeBSD 6.x, Apache+PHP+Mysql. Объем контента вместе с базами не превышает сейчас 1Гб. Сервер практически не загружен, но по некоторым причинам не хочется его совмещать с чем-то. Тут скорее всего тоже решение из п.1, только объем HDD можно увеличить до 250Гб (возможно необходимо будет поднять небольшой ftp-сервер).

4. Сервер статистики и управления пользователями локальной сети.
OC FreeBSD 6.x, IPFW, SQUID, получение статистики netflow от нескольких сенсоров, ежечасный подсчет трафика.
Вот тут не совсем понятно с конфигурацией. Основная нагрузка на сервер в момент обсчета базы со статистикой netflow и с данными squid’a. Ежемесячный прирост базы порядка 20Gb, но это не означает, что все данные все время хранятся на этом сервере. В базе присутствует статистика только за последние 3 месяца. Остальная информация дампится и сливается в архив на другую машину.
Подойдет ли сюда решение на Core2Duo(Quad), с 4Gb RAM, RAID Adaptec 3405, 4х73Gb SAS в RAID 10?

5. DC.
ОС Windows 2003 Server, AD, DNS, Wins, WSUS, Kaspersky
Кол-во клиентов в домене около 250. Возможно увеличится, но не намного. Основным потребителем, как оказалось, выступает административная консоль от Касперского. В среднем загрузка процессора редко поднимается выше 10%.
Думаю, что тоже подойдет Core2Duo(Quad), с 4Gb RAM, и 2-мя HDD по 250Gb. Отдельный RAID-контроллер, думаю, что не нужен.

6. Большая файлопомойка.
OC Windows 2003 Server
Необходимо дисковое пространство по принципу чем больше тем лучше. Скорость записи и чтения особенно не важна. Время на восстановление после отказа какого-либо из дисков тоже не играет роли. При необходимости, можно просто отключить сервер от сети и пересобрать массив. Из того, что есть у Supermicro, понравилось шасси SC836TQ .
Подскажите (и посчитайте), пожалуйста, конфигурацию с использованием вышеуказанного шасси. Изначально, в целях экономии, планируем установить 8 дисков по 750Гб SATA в raid 5, а потом добавить (по необходимости) еще 5 дисков.

Если нужна какая-либо дополнительная информация, спрашивайте. Постараюсь ответить.
Все это в Санкт-Петербурге.

Заранее спасибо.

Аватара пользователя
VendeTTa
Advanced member
Сообщения: 350
Зарегистрирован: 09 фев 2004, 15:21
Откуда: Санкт-Петербург
Контактная информация:

Сообщение VendeTTa » 12 мар 2008, 14:45

где-то так..

1. 5015M-U\Q6600\2GB\3405\2x250GB SATA
2. 5015M-U\Q6600\2GB\3405\2x146GB SAS
3. 5015M-U\Q6600\4GB\3405\4x73 SAS
4. 5015M-U\Q6600\4GB\3405+BBU\4x73 SAS
5. 5015B-MT\Q6600\2GB\2x250GB SATA
6. X7SBE\X6750\2GB\3405\8x750GB SATA\836-E1

Все на почту выслал.

vinnispb
Junior member
Сообщения: 4
Зарегистрирован: 10 мар 2008, 14:50
Откуда: Санкт-Петербург

Сообщение vinnispb » 12 мар 2008, 15:17

Спасибо за ответ.
Письма пока не получил. Жду.

Есть пара вопросов по последней конфигурации (п.6)
Имеется в виду процессор Core2Duo 2.66G/1333MHz/4M?
Вы указали контроллер Adaptec 3405. Он вроде бы 4-х портовый. А надо 16.

Аватара пользователя
VendeTTa
Advanced member
Сообщения: 350
Зарегистрирован: 09 фев 2004, 15:21
Откуда: Санкт-Петербург
Контактная информация:

Сообщение VendeTTa » 12 мар 2008, 15:47

Да, машинально написал, конечно E6750 - 2.66Ггц c FSB 1333.
836-E1 подключается через экспандер к 4-х канальному контроллеру.

vinnispb
Junior member
Сообщения: 4
Зарегистрирован: 10 мар 2008, 14:50
Откуда: Санкт-Петербург

Сообщение vinnispb » 12 мар 2008, 16:19

Получил письмо. Спасибо.

Еще вопрос.
836-E1 подключается через экспандер к 4-х канальному контроллеру.
Я понял, что имеется в виду вот это: SC836 SAS Backplane with LSI SASX28 Expander Chip?

для того, чтобы добавить еще 8 дисков достаточно просто их добавить в свободные слоты?

Если вопросы появятся лучше в форум кидать или письмом?

Аватара пользователя
VendeTTa
Advanced member
Сообщения: 350
Зарегистрирован: 09 фев 2004, 15:21
Откуда: Санкт-Петербург
Контактная информация:

Сообщение VendeTTa » 12 мар 2008, 16:38

да, просто добавить в корзинки.
вопросы можно задавать в удобном виде.
Конечно, что качается коммерческой  информации лучше в почту.

Аватара пользователя
Stranger03
Сотрудник Тринити
Сотрудник Тринити
Сообщения: 12979
Зарегистрирован: 14 ноя 2003, 16:25
Откуда: СПб, Екатеринбург
Контактная информация:

Re: Конфигурация нескольких серверов под FreeBSD и Win2003

Сообщение Stranger03 » 13 мар 2008, 10:10

vinnispb писал(а):2. Почтовый сервер.
ОС FreeBSD 6.x, Postfix, spamassassin, Mysql, drweb. Среднее кол-во писем, доставляемых ежесуточно в ящики (т.е. не считая спама, отброшенного на разных этапах проверок) около 2 тысяч. Объем почтовых ящиков около 20Гб.
Сколько пользователей? Где будет хранится почта? ИМАП? ПОП3?
ИМХО я бы тут поставил дисков штучек 4-е, в остальном как Алексей.
информация дампится и сливается в архив на другую машину.
Подойдет ли сюда решение на Core2Duo(Quad), с 4Gb RAM, RAID Adaptec 3405, 4х73Gb SAS в RAID 10?
Очень интересный вопрос, в зависимости от размера обрабатываемых данных (размера лога сквида например) может понадобится и посерьезнее машина. Пока в принципе Q6600 + 4-е диска САС. Но не прогнозируемо.
6. Большая файлопомойка.
OC Windows 2003 Server
Необходимо дисковое пространство по принципу чем больше тем лучше. Скорость записи и чтения особенно не важна. Время на восстановление после отказа какого-либо из дисков тоже не играет роли. При необходимости, можно просто отключить сервер от сети и пересобрать массив.
Я бы поставил 745TQ кузов.

vinnispb
Junior member
Сообщения: 4
Зарегистрирован: 10 мар 2008, 14:50
Откуда: Санкт-Петербург

Re: Конфигурация нескольких серверов под FreeBSD и Win2003

Сообщение vinnispb » 13 мар 2008, 21:26

to Stranger03
Спасибо за ответ.
Сколько пользователей? Где будет хранится почта? ИМАП? ПОП3?
Формат хранения почты - maildir. Если я правильно понял вопрос. Кол-во ящиков - около 500.

судя по iostat нагрузка, я бы сказал, плавающая.
бывает так:

Код: Выделить всё

iostat -d 1 10
             ad0
  KB/t tps  MB/s
  0.00   0  0.00
 25.59 162  4.05
 35.39 200  6.91
 29.36 219  6.27
 32.72 177  5.66
 28.07 121  3.31
 31.73 231  7.15
 31.03 295  8.95
 35.81 257  8.97
 26.54 269  6.98
а бывает вот так:

Код: Выделить всё

iostat -d 1 10
             ad0
  KB/t tps  MB/s
  0.00   0  0.00
  0.00   0  0.00
  0.00   0  0.00
  0.00   0  0.00
  5.56  63  0.34
  6.00   4  0.02
  5.33   3  0.02
 14.74  21  0.30
  0.00   0  0.00
  0.00   0  0.00
Алексей предложил поставить 2 по 147G. В чем будет отличие если поставить 4 по 73?

По поводу сервера статистики.
Очень интересный вопрос, в зависимости от размера обрабатываемых данных (размера лога сквида например) может понадобится и посерьезнее машина.
Размер лога сквида сказать не могу, т.к. он сразу в mysql налету пишется. В целом получается, что на этой машине сейчас в сутки в базу добавляется около 1 млн. записей squid и 5 млн. записей netflow.

Могу сказать, что предложенная для этого сервера конфигурация - это уже круто по сравнению с тем что есть сейчас.
Я бы поставил 745TQ кузов.
На сколько я понял в этот кузов без дополнительных прибамбасов можно поставить только 8 дисков. А надо 16.

Аватара пользователя
Stranger03
Сотрудник Тринити
Сотрудник Тринити
Сообщения: 12979
Зарегистрирован: 14 ноя 2003, 16:25
Откуда: СПб, Екатеринбург
Контактная информация:

Re: Конфигурация нескольких серверов под FreeBSD и Win2003

Сообщение Stranger03 » 14 мар 2008, 09:32

vinnispb писал(а):Алексей предложил поставить 2 по 147G. В чем будет отличие если поставить 4 по 73?
Больше шпинделей, выше скорость записи и чтения. Хотя судя по статистике нагрузка не велика, странно даже, на 500 юзеров. Режим кеширования на клиентах включен?
Размер лога сквида сказать не могу, т.к. он сразу в mysql налету пишется. В целом получается, что на этой машине сейчас в сутки в базу добавляется около 1 млн. записей squid и 5 млн. записей netflow.

Могу сказать, что предложенная для этого сервера конфигурация - это уже круто по сравнению с тем что есть сейчас.
Ну наверно, если по текущему серверу устраивает производительность, то смысла наворачивать нет, новый стервер будет в разы быстрее.
На сколько я понял в этот кузов без дополнительных прибамбасов можно поставить только 8 дисков. А надо 16.
16-ть дисков по 750ГБ? Чего вы там такого храните то?

Ответить

Вернуться в «Серверы - Конфигурирование»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 21 гость